Termination of an Application Sample Clauses

The 'Termination of an Application' clause defines the conditions and procedures under which a party may end or withdraw an application before it is fully processed or completed. Typically, this clause outlines the steps required to notify the other party, any notice periods, and the consequences of termination, such as forfeiture of fees or return of submitted materials. Its core function is to provide a clear and fair process for discontinuing an application, thereby protecting both parties from uncertainty or disputes regarding the status of the application.
Termination of an Application. Customer shall have the option at any time before the end of the Term to terminate any Application by giving Sensus one hundred twenty (120) days prior written notice. Such notice, once delivered to Sensus, is irrevocable. Should Customer elect to terminate any Application, Customer acknowledges that; (a) Customer shall pay all applicable fees, including any unpaid Software as a Service fees due in the current calendar year plus a ten percent (10%) early termination fee, where such fee is calculated based on the annual Software as a Service fee due in the current calendar year; and (b) Software as a Service for such Application shall immediately cease. If Customer elects to terminate the RNI Application in the Software as a Service environment but does not terminate the Agreement generally, then upon delivery of the notice to Sensus, Customer shall purchase the necessary (a) RNI hardware from a third party and (b) RNI software license at Sensus' then-current pricing. No portion of the Software as a Service fees shall be applied to the purchase of the RNI hardware or software license.

  • Termination of an Issuing Bank The Borrower may terminate the appointment of any Issuing Bank as an “Issuing Bank” hereunder by providing a written notice thereof to such Issuing Bank, with a copy to the Administrative Agent. Any such termination shall become effective upon the earlier of (i) such Issuing Bank’s acknowledging receipt of such notice and (ii) the fifth Business Day following the date of the delivery thereof; provided that no such termination shall become effective until and unless the LC Exposure attributable to Letters of Credit issued by such Issuing Bank (or its Affiliates) shall have been reduced to zero. At the time any such termination shall become effective, the Borrower shall pay all unpaid fees accrued for the account of the terminated Issuing Bank pursuant to Section 2.12(b). Notwithstanding the effectiveness of any such termination, the terminated Issuing Bank shall remain a party hereto and shall continue to have all the rights of an Issuing Bank under this Agreement with respect to Letters of Credit issued by it prior to such termination, but shall not issue any additional Letters of Credit.

  • Termination of Engagement (a) This Agreement shall terminate (i) immediately upon the death of Consultant, (ii) at the option of either party hereto without cause upon thirty (30) days advance written notice from the terminating party to the other party, or (iii) upon the termination of this Agreement by the Contractor for "cause." For the purposes of this Agreement, "cause" shall mean (i) any act by Consultant of fraud or dishonesty (whether or not against or involving the Contractor), (ii) Consultant's competing with the business of the Contractor either directly or indirectly, (iii) Consultant's breach of any material provision of this Agreement, (iv) Consultant's failure to devote his best efforts to his duties under this Agreement or to perform such duties diligently and efficiently and in accordance with the directions of the Contractor or to otherwise fulfill his obligations under this Agreement, (v) Consultant's failure to comply with the decisions or policies of the Contractor, (vi) any act of moral turpitude by Consultant or (vii) any other matter constituting "cause" under applicable law.
